This must come up after every release of KDE and Gnome and <insert popular program here>. Programs are only marked stable after they've passed extensive testing under many different architectures and scenarios. 3.5 may be stable for you and I, but not for everyone... As I recall, kde-3.4 never went stable, 3.4.1 did however. So don't expect it to be anytime soon. _________________ emerge --info
